Mikael Seppälä

Living Labs Specialist at Laurea University of Applied Sciences

Mikael Seppälä is a neo-generalist with a unique approach to examining phenomena across various disciplines to understand their impact on the future of work and collaboration.

His main goal is to enhance the human aspect of work and organizations by fostering Responsive Organizations capable of adapting to changing environments through embracing Complexity, Humanistic and Participatory organizing methods, and leveraging AI and social technologies.

Mikael's expertise stems from his background in Enterprise Architecture, particularly in the Business & Data domains, and Service Design. He is passionate about Network Theory, Systems Thinking, and Complexity Science, which collectively enable him to navigate seamlessly from strategic overview to practical implementation.

He pursued his education at various institutions including The English School of Helsinki for his High School Diploma, Laurea University of Applied Sciences for a Master of Business Administration (MBA), University of Helsinki for a Master of Arts, and University of Jyväskylä for both a Master of Science in Economics and Business Administration and a Master of Social Sciences.

Throughout his career, Mikael Seppälä has held key roles such as Living Labs Specialist at Laurea University of Applied Sciences, Co-Founder at Systems Change Finland, Partner at Systems Innovation focusing on Systems Change, and Writer and editorial board member at Tietojohtaminen ry.
